A novel service-oriented intelligent seamless migration algorithm and application for pervasive computing environments

被引:2
|
作者
Cai, Haibin [1 ,2 ]
Peng, Chao [1 ]
Deng, Robert H. [4 ]
Jiang, Linhua [1 ,3 ]
机构
[1] E China Normal Univ, Shanghai Key Lab Trustworthy Comp, Shanghai 200062, Peoples R China
[2] Beijing Jiaotong Univ, State Key Lab Rail Traff Control & Safety, Beijing 100044, Peoples R China
[3] Stanford Univ, Stanford, CA 94305 USA
[4] Singapore Management Univ, Sch Informat Syst, Singapore 178902, Singapore
来源
FUTURE GENERATION COMPUTER SYSTEMS-THE INTERNATIONAL JOURNAL OF ESCIENCE | 2013年 / 29卷 / 08期
关键词
Pervasive computing; Service failure; Seamless; Service migration;
D O I
10.1016/j.future.2013.02.008
中图分类号
TP301 [理论、方法];
学科分类号
081202 ;
摘要
How to improve the reliability and efficiency of a system is one of the most important issues in the pervasive computing domain. Fault tolerance and process migration are the effective methods of improving system's reliability and efficiency. In this paper, we propose a service-oriented intelligent seamless migration (SOISM) mechanism and algorithm for pervasive computing environments. We introduce the architecture of the service migration system, design and implement a service fault detector and a service fault manager. We propose two judgment theorems of triggering a service migration activity and completing a successful service migration activity. We also adopt a method of optimizing service migration route among the service resource networks by scheduling to minimize average completion time. We have implemented the SOISM mechanism in an intelligent service selection prototype (ISSPS) system which provides the pervasive web services for users for pervasive computing environments. We have fulfilled various simulations and the results show that the proposed service selection and migration mechanism is not only reliable but also efficient. (C) 2013 Elsevier B.V. All rights reserved.
引用
收藏
页码:1919 / 1930
页数:12
相关论文
共 50 条
  • [31] Designing for service-oriented computing
    Hellenic Open University, Greece
    J. Cases Inf. Technol., 2007, 1 (36-53):
  • [32] Service-oriented and cloud computing
    Soldani, Jacopo
    Papadopoulos, George A.
    Rademacher, Florian
    COMPUTING, 2024, 106 (11) : 3387 - 3387
  • [33] Service-oriented architecture and computing
    Purao, Sandeep
    Khatri, Vijay
    Cameron, Brian
    Journal of Database Management, 2011, 22 (02)
  • [34] Designing for Service-Oriented Computing
    Vassiliadis, Bill
    JOURNAL OF CASES ON INFORMATION TECHNOLOGY, 2007, 9 (01) : 36 - 53
  • [35] Calculi for Service-Oriented Computing
    Bruni, Roberto
    FORMAL METHODS FOR WEB SERVICES, 2009, 5569 : 1 - 41
  • [36] On service-oriented symbolic computing
    Carstea, Alexandru
    Frincu, Marc
    Konovalov, Alexander
    Macariu, Georgiana
    Petcu, Dana
    PARALLEL PROCESSING AND APPLIED MATHEMATICS, 2008, 4967 : 843 - +
  • [37] Negotiating in service-oriented environments
    Elfatatry, AM
    Layzell, PJ
    COMMUNICATIONS OF THE ACM, 2004, 47 (08) : 103 - 108
  • [38] A service-oriented approach for the pervasive learning grid
    Liao, CJ
    Yang, FCO
    Hsu, KC
    JOURNAL OF INFORMATION SCIENCE AND ENGINEERING, 2005, 21 (05) : 959 - 971
  • [39] Conflict Management in Service-Oriented Pervasive Platforms
    Lalanda, Philippe
    Ben Hadj, Rania
    Hamon, Catherine
    Vega, German
    2017 IEEE INTERNATIONAL CONFERENCE ON SERVICES COMPUTING (SCC), 2017, : 249 - 256
  • [40] Autonomic service-oriented context for pervasive applications
    Aygalinc, Colin
    Gerbert-Gaillard, Eva
    Vega, German
    Lalanda, Philippe
    Chollet, Stephanie
    PROCEEDINGS 2016 IEEE INTERNATIONAL CONFERENCE ON SERVICES COMPUTING (SCC 2016), 2016, : 491 - 498